Registration now open for the annual Pitt-Greensburg golf outing

Golfers on the putting greenThe University of Pittsburgh at Greensburg invites golfers to register for its annual golf outing, presented by Elliott Group. The outing will be held Friday, October 1, at the Latrobe Country Club (346 Arnold Palmer Drive, Latrobe, PA 15650). Early bird registration at $175 per golfer or $700 per foursome will be accepted through September 9. After September 9, registration will increase to $200 (individual) and $800 (foursome). The day begins at 8 a.m. with registration and a 9 a.m. shotgun start (four-player scramble). As part of their registration, golfers receive 18 holes of golf with cart, skills contests on the course, use of the putting green, giveaways and team prizes, complimentary beverages, food stations on the course, bag drop service and locker room access, as well as a foursome photo. Pitt-Greensburg alumni will have fun competing for bragging rights and to have their names engraved on the perpetual Alumni Foursome Challenge Trophy. This honor is given to the outing’s highest placing foursome that includes a Pitt-Greensburg alumnus or alumna.

Golfers in golf carts ready for the shot gun startProceeds from the golf outing benefit Pitt-Greensburg Athletics, the Pitt-Greensburg Alumni Association (PGAA), and Pitt-Greensburg’s Technology for the Future Challenge Fund. Funds designated to the Technology for the Future Fund will be matched dollar-for-dollar by the Department of Education through a matching grant.
